Hobcaw Point Mount Pleasant, SC

Hobcaw is the native American word for land between the waters. The name is a perfect fit for this beautiful neighborhood which has two tidal creeks (Molasses and Hobcaw) as its borders that flow into the Wando River.

Historically, this area was once the base for production of timber and building of ships, particularly during the colonial era. Hobcaw later became the hub of Charleston's city powder magazines. Now, the quiet and natural ambiance is evident despite the rapid changes happening around Mount Pleasant.

A beautiful and established neighborhood, Hobcaw Point, is one of Mount Pleasant's favorite communities for water lovers. Some of the homes have water access and an amazing view of the waterfront. Most of the lots are a minimum of half an acre while those lots close to the Yacht Club are smaller. There about 371 houses. A few of the homes date back to 1952, and most have been renovated. This friendly community is filled with breathtaking oaks and azaleas and features a beautiful park for children and the young at heart.

Hobcaw Point Real Estate

Hobcaw Point not only has no neighborhood covenants and restrictions but there is also no homeowners association fee or transfer fees. You do have the option of joining the Hobcaw Yacht Club. As a member, you may access waterfront activities, an Olympic sized indoor pool, and a Club House which members can rent for private events. The Yacht Club offers a children's swim team and a sailing camp.

Thirteen Hobcaw Point homes ranging from $450,000 to $3,000,000 were sold in 2017. The median sales price* was $783,000.

*Half of the houses were sold for a higher price, the other half for a lower price.
